Now, let’s get to the main question – can you screenshot a Tinder profile? The answer is yes, you can. Screenshotting a Tinder profile is a common practice among users, especially when they come across a profile that catches their eye. It is an easy way to save a profile for later or share it with friends. However, it is essential to be respectful and ask for permission before screenshotting someone’s profile.

To take a screenshot of a Tinder profile, you can simply press the power button and the volume down button (on most Android devices) or the power button and the home button (on most iOS devices) at the same time. This will save the screenshot to your device’s camera roll or gallery. You can then crop the screenshot to focus on the profile and share it with others.

IIRC, which stands for “if I remember correctly,” is an acronym commonly used in texting and online communication. It is often utilized when someone wants to express uncertainty about the accuracy of their statement or when they want to preface a statement with a disclaimer. In this article, we will explore the origins and usage of IIRC, its evolution in digital communication, and the impact it has on our conversations. Additionally, we will discuss other popular acronyms used in texting and how they contribute to the ever-changing landscape of online communication.

The use of acronyms in communication has become increasingly prevalent with the rise of texting and instant messaging platforms. These short forms, such as IIRC, enable users to convey their messages more efficiently and quickly. IIRC is particularly useful when sharing information that is not completely certain or when relying on one’s memory. By using this acronym, individuals can provide a caveat that allows others to evaluate the information with a degree of skepticism.

The origin of IIRC can be traced back to the early days of online forums and chat rooms. In these digital spaces, users often engaged in conversations that required referencing past discussions or recalling specific details. As the internet grew, the need for concise and easily understandable language became apparent. Thus, acronyms like IIRC started to emerge as a way to streamline communication.

How to Uninstall and Reinstall Snapchat on iPhone

Snapchat is a popular social media app that allows users to send and receive photos, videos, and messages that disappear after a certain period of time. However, there may be times when you encounter issues with the app, such as glitches, crashes, or other technical problems. In such cases, one of the best troubleshooting steps is to uninstall and reinstall the app. This article will guide you through the process of uninstalling and reinstalling Snapchat on your iPhone, providing step-by-step instructions and additional tips to ensure a smooth reinstallation.

Uninstalling Snapchat on iPhone:
1. Locate the Snapchat app icon on your iPhone’s home screen. It is a yellow icon with a white ghost in the center.
2. Press and hold the Snapchat app icon until it starts shaking, and a small “x” appears on the top-left corner of the icon.
3. Tap the “x” on the Snapchat app icon. A pop-up message will appear, asking if you want to delete the app.
4. Tap the “Delete” button to confirm the deletion. The Snapchat app will be uninstalled from your iPhone.

Reinstalling Snapchat on iPhone:

1. Open the App Store on your iPhone. It is a blue icon with a white “A” inside a circle.
2. Tap the “Search” tab at the bottom of the screen and type “Snapchat” in the search bar at the top.
3. From the search results, find the Snapchat app and tap on it to open the app page.
4. On the Snapchat app page, tap the “Get” or “Download” button. The button will change to “Install” and then a loading circle.
5. If prompted, enter your Apple ID password or use Touch ID or Face ID to authenticate the installation.
6. Wait for the Snapchat app to finish downloading and installing on your iPhone. You can track the progress by monitoring the loading circle on the app icon.
7. Once the installation is complete, the Snapchat app will appear on your iPhone’s home screen.
